Hannah Molloy is a canine behavioural therapist and dog trainer who runs a company in Birmingham called Pawfect Dogsense. Recently she was asked to be part of Channel 4’s new 3 part show, Puppy School. We caught up with Hannah to find out more about it... You’ve got some exciting things coming up in March? So yes, I am about to feature as one of the experts on Channel 4’s new show Puppy School!
Tell us more about the show... So, Puppy School is a show that is gonna look at why people get puppies. Everybody has a dog for different reasons and that’s something I see every day when I’m working. The Puppy School environment is a really unique place where people from lots of different backgrounds can come together and learn about dogs, so what we tried to do with Puppy School is teach people about positive training and really look into the stories of the contributors and the reasons why some of these people have got puppies. So yeah it’s going to be a really compassionate look at the ownership really.
Well that sounds like an interesting take on it, so what are some of the reasons people get dogs then? There are lots of reasons that people get dogs, and I’m not going to give you any spoilers because people are looking forward to watching (the show) when it airs. But I mean, if you think about the ages and stages of people, there are loads of reasons. Maybe you are just retired and you want a new project and you’ve got a bit of an empty nest and
8
Hannah Molloy the kids have moved away and you’d like something to focus your energy on. Sometimes people will get them because they’ve had a really difficult situation happen in their life and having a puppy and raising a puppy is a really lovely way of getting back out into the world and just taking life with both hands again. So it’s been really beautiful to watch some of these stories develop. I think you’re gonna laugh as much as you are gonna cry, and there’s some really beautiful and sometimes quite sad stories.
So the show is called Puppy School and it’s airing in March, but we don’t know the dates yet? No, don’t know yet, so you’ve got to keep your ear to the ground and Channel Four will announce when the programme is ready to go out. You know I’m waiting just as much as you are to find out when it’s going to happen! We’ve completely finished filming it now and people are working really hard to make a great show out of it which I don’t think is going to be difficult because we’ve had some really great people and some amazing stories, and we’ve got three experts. The beautiful thing about Puppy School is you’ve got me, you’ve got a lovely trainer called Oli Juste and another trainer called Katie Patmore, and between the three of us we’ve got a sort of smorgasbord of experience. About 100 years worth of training experience, when you add it all up.
So did you completely agree on everything? More or less! Yeah! Often. To be honest the fundamentals of what we believe in are the same. We all believe in positive training, we all believe in setting dogs up to succeed and reinforcing behaviour more than punishing it. Because the science shows that rewarding positive behaviour works. Punishment is a tricky one, if you punish a dog it might be a short fix to deal with a problem but long term you’ll probably find that the punishment will need to increase. Whereas if you keep reinforcing good behaviour that’s gonna stick because it’s worth it for the dog or for the person, so we all believe in positive reinforcement.
Because it gives them the motivation to do the right thing? Exactly, yes. It’s finding what that individual dog wants to do or wants to work for - or the person. You know, people are trainable in just the same way by providing access to those rewards.
You say people are trainable in the same way, is it the people that you’re training rather than the puppies, in Puppy School? Yeah! (laughs)
So Puppy School is really Puppy Owner School? Exactly, 100%. You know, human beings have had dogs for like 20,000 years and I think sometimes we forget that a lot of these dogs had jobs originally that we’re not really giving them access to anymore. Being a pet is probably the hardest job a dog can do because they’re expected to sit at home, be petted and chatted to all day and so more often than not, teaching the owner how to set the dog up to succeed is actually what we do... it’s human training!

The 11 is a 27 mile route around the suburbs of Birmingham and happens to be steeped in history. Indeed, Birmingham Corporation Tramways once – somewhat optimistically – tried to market the 11 as a tourist attraction (see their campaign above). End-to-end (or rather, to and from whichever point within the circle you get on and off at), the 11A/11C takes around 3 hours to complete, and if you stay on all the way round, you’ll find yourself passing a seemingly endless procession of 233 educational establishments, 69 leisure and community centres, 40 pubs, 19 shopping centres, six hospitals, a prison…and even a chocolate factory. transportdesigned.com

SWEET POTATO & GOATS CHEESE TART 3 tbsp olive oil 2 medium red onions 5 tbsp balsamic vinegar 4 medium sweet potatoes, peeled, cut small 1 tsp chilli flakes 1 pack ready to roll puff pastry 1 pack goats cheese 1 egg, beaten, for glazing 1 tsp thyme 2 cloves garlic METHOD Step 1 Heat oven to 200C/180C fan/ gas 6. Place cut up sweet potato onto a baking tray and drizzle over half of the oil. Season with salt and pepper, dust over the chilli flakes and shake the tray before placing in the oven for 20 mins. Remove after 10 minutes to shake the tray and return to the oven for the remaining 10 minutes. Step 2
Chop the onions and put them in a frying pan with the remaining oil on a low heat for 10 minutes. Add the chopped garlic, after five minutes add in the balsamic vinegar. after 5 minutes remove from the heat.
Step 3
Check that the sweet potatoes are softening and turning lightly brown and take them out to cool.
Step 4
Using butter or oil grease the baking tray for your tart and place the pastry inside draping over the edges. Try to evenly spread the onions across the base of the pastry, and then add in the sweet potatoes. roughly cut the goats cheese into cubes and scatter evenly across the top and sprinkle with thyme.
Step 5
Fold the edges of the pastry in on itself and lightly coat the pastry with the beaten egg. Then place the tray into the oven for 20 - 30 minutes or until pastry is risen and golden brown.
Serve warm with a rocket salad. This is a great dish to freeze in portions and have a delicious easy meal ready for whenever.

Broken Promises and Property Rights – Where Do You Stand?
As private client solicitors, we have seen a steady rise in the number of proprietary estoppel claims brought in recent years. What Is ‘Proprietary Estoppel’?
An Example
Broadly, this principle enables the courts to decide whether an individual has acquired a right to property because of promises made to them in the past, which they have relied upon to their detriment, in the absence of a written agreement.
Michael has two adult children, Jane and Mary. Michael becomes seriously ill and promises Jane that if she moves in with him and becomes his fulltime carer, she will inherit the family home on his death. Jane quits her job and moves in with her father to care for him. When Michael passes away years later, his will leaves the family home to Jane’s sister, Mary. Jane may be successful in bringing a proprietary estoppel claim, against her late father’s Estate.
In order to succeed in such a claim, three essential criteria must be met: • a representation, assurance or promise made to them • reliance upon it • detriment suffered as a result of reasonably relying upon it
A Recent Case The case of Habberfied v Habberfield was heard in Bristol earlier this year and involved a family farm and, as is often the case, a breakdown in family relationships.

WWW.VWV.COM Lucy, one of four siblings, began working full time on the farm in 1983 at the age of 16. She worked up to 87.5 hours per week and received very low pay, based on her parents’ assurances that she would eventually inherit the farm. In 2013, following a fight with her sister, Lucy left the farm. When her father died in 2014, he left the whole of his interest in the farm to Lucy’s mother.
What Should You Do if You Find Yourself in a Similar Situation?
Lucy successfully brought a proprietary estoppel claim against her mother. The court found that various representations had been made to Lucy over an extended period. These assurances were ‘an operative cause’ of Lucy working long hours for low pay and holiday, and not pursuing her own dairy farming business. The farm was valued at approximately £2.5 million and Lucy was awarded a lump sum payment of £1.17 million as compensation rather than awarding her the whole farm to fulfil the promise.
If you find yourself in this situation our advice is that you should try to achieve a legally drafted agreement setting out the arrangement, however difficult, rather than have to rely on bringing hugely expensive court proceedings later down the line, with an uncertain outcome.
In a family relationship based on trust, it is often very hard for an adult child to demand their parent to commit a promise into a legally binding written agreement. As a result, proprietary estoppel is a notoriously complex area of law and outcomes can be difficult to predict.
